Does anybody know what the startermotor is off because mine is screeching, is it possible to change the little cog("bendix"?) on its own? presuming thats all that has worn ??
The starter motor screeching is likely to be the dog clutch refusing to disingange after the engine has started. Unfortunately this will destroy the startermotor in fairly short order. It is however easy to remedy with a good clean up and a bit of grease. However likely the starter motor has to come out to achieve it.
ok ive had the starter out three times now, cleaned it up etc and found one of the brushes stuck in, but still no luck. So i,ve been matching them up to other models and found it is the same as a Nissan Maxima 3.0 inj V6 88 -94 J30 model
Part no ADN 11248. just got to find one in the country now. ill keep you posted

TooTall Paul said:
Ok quick update just fitted a nissan maxima starter and it works perfectly just make sure you get the 3.0 inj auto version 88 -94, See how long it lasts now !!!

spartacus said:
Guys, I want to put this on Part Number thread.
So just to confirm I have read this correctly:
The part number is PTC 130/30 (is that original part number?)
RS stock number is 455-3744
This gives you the contact options of NC or NO, cerbera needs NC so discard NO.
brown wire = nc
green = no
white = common
